Buying Biotech Stocks? Be Cautious.

Biotech stocks are hot again this year as investors hope for spectacular gains like last year. In 2014, biotech stocks returned more than 34%. While the NASDAQ is up by 7.5% year-to-date (YTD) the NYSE Arca Biotech Index has shot up by 19.2% YTD. The following chart shows the 10-year price return of the largest biotech ETF – iShares …
